Description

A presentation of some tools written in Clojure for making music software (conventional products like Ableton Live, or live coding environments like Overtone) more amenable to live performance: a dynamic layer-based rendering library for the monome and arc control surfaces (shado) and a DSL-based generator and loader of multitouch interface templates for the Lemur (sifaka). If there's (development) time we can also outline the design of a networked "social looper" audio plugin for Ableton Live, built with MaxMSP, Clojure and Noir.
